The Strategic Imperative: Why Dynamic Visuals Are Non-Negotiable

Many creators opt for faceless videos for privacy or efficiency, but this choice comes with a key challenge: how do you hold a viewer's attention? Without a human face, your visuals must do the heavy lifting. Dynamic visuals are not just a nice-to-have; they are the core of your communication.

Dynamic visuals can :

Boost Engagement: Rapid cuts, animated graphics, and text overlays prevent viewer fatigue and keep them engaged.

Explain Complex Ideas: Visual metaphors and animations can simplify abstract concepts, making your content more digestible.

Build a Brand Identity: Your choice of fonts, colours, and visual effects becomes your signature, solidifying a unique brand identity without a face.

Drive SEO & Watch Time: Compelling visuals lead to longer watch times, which signals to the algorithm that your content is valuable, boosting its visibility.

Leveraging AI & Tools for Dynamic Visuals (The "How-To" Guide)

This is where the magic happens and where your partnership with AI can truly shine. You don't need to be a professional animator to create stunning visuals. Here are the tools and strategies to master:

1. AI-Powered Video Generation:

 AI as a Visual Partner: Some tools and AI features can generate visuals from simple text prompts. For example, a prompt like “a futuristic city skyline with data streams flowing” can instantly create a unique background that aligns with your brand.

Seamless Integration: Use these AI-generated clips to transition between sections of your video or to illustrate a key point without the need for stock footage.

2. Curating with Stock Media Libraries:

A Goldmine of Content: Platforms that offer high-quality, professional video clips and animations that are ready to use.

Search for Your Aesthetic: Instead of just searching for general topics, use keywords that match your brand’s feel.

Give Credit: Always remember to check the licensing and give credit to the original creators, like the fantastic work when possible. This is a crucial step in being a responsible creator.

3. Mastering Your Editing Tools (like CapCut)

Aspect Ratio is King: For Youtube, starting your project in 16:9 or 4:3 ratio is essential, but always switch to a vertical 9:16 aspect ratio for Shorts, Reels, and TikTok.

Animated Text & Graphics: Use your favourite software to build in text templates, animations, and stickers. These features are easy to use and can quickly add a professional, dynamic feel to your video.

Merging Clips Seamlessly: Avoid jarring transitions. Use precise trimming and snapping features to merge similar clips, creating a natural, repetitive loop that feels intentional rather than like a cut. This is key for creating smooth, flowing visuals.


Essential Considerations for Visual Success

  • Licensing & Attribution: Before using any visual media, always check the licensing. Most free stock sites are royalty-free, but some require attribution. Always give credit to avoid any copyright issues.
  • Consistency is Key: Your visuals, fonts, and colour palette should be consistent across your content. This builds a recognizable brand identity over time.

  • Quality over Quantity: A few high-quality, well-chosen clips are far more effective than a video full of low-quality, random visuals.
